Our microschool serves families seeking a flexible learning environment.
Families may choose full-day, every-day enrollment (8:30-3:30) or attend by academic block. Students attend ELA and Math on Mondays & Wednesdays or History, Applied Math, and Science on Tuesdays & Thursdays. Complete academic core classes would be Monday through Friday, allowing students to learn from all topics and have more one on one help during our Friday morning student hall. This structure allows families to stay closely involved in their child’s education while maintaining a consistent school rhythm and peer group.
Students learn in small, mixed age groups. Learning is hands on and discussion based, supported with minimal screen use. Our consistent daily schedule includes academics, group meetings, physical education, and outdoor recess.
Every day includes a shared lunch and unstructured outdoor play when weather allows. This is an important part of our approach that supports social growth, creativity, and relationship-building in a relaxed, child-led way.

Our Middle School Core Program is designed to prepare students for high school-level expectations through rigorous academics, structured accountability, and increasing independence.
Students engage in deeper analysis, longer-term projects, collaborative discussions, and meaningful technology integration.
Language Arts (Mondays & Wednesdays)
Literature analysis
Structured essays and research writing
Grammar and vocabulary refinement
Mathematics (All Days)
Pre-algebra through advanced middle school math
Multi-step problem-solving
Applied mathematical reasoning
History & Social Studies (Tuesdays & Thursdays)
Thematic and chronological historical study
Primary source exposure
Analytical discussion and written response
Science
Laboratory-style investigations
Data collection and analysis
Scientific reasoning and documentation
Middle school students regularly use technology to:
Create and present research projects
Develop digital documents and presentations
Collaborate using Google Workspace tools
Learn organizational systems for digital assignments
Technology is used intentionally to teach process, responsibility, and digital literacy.
